业余高水平到精英级女性攀岩运动员的人体测量学和表现特征。

Anthropometry and performance characteristics of recreational advanced to elite female rock climbers.

Abstract

Despite climbing's popularity and an increasing number of female participants, there are limited anthropometric and performance data for this population. This study compares the characteristics of 55 experienced female climbers, divided into three categories (lower [ADV-L] and higher advanced [ADV-H] and elite [ELT]) based on self-reported ability. Data on climbing experience, body dimensions, body composition, flexibility, lower and upper-body power and finger strength were assessed. ELT climbers differed significantly from the ADV groups in age (Mean Difference [MD] = 8.8-9.8 yrs; despite smaller differences in years climbing MD = 1.6-2.4 yrs), greater climbing and hours training per week (MD = 3.0-3.7 h & MD = 0.9-1.6 h, respectively), and greater upper-body power (MD = 12.9-16.6 cm) and finger strength (MD = 51.6-65.4 N). Linear regression analysis showed finger strength and upper body power to be associated with ability, particularly when adjusting for descriptive and anthropometric variables (finger strength R = 53% and 45%; upper-body power R = 60% and 39% for boulder and sport, respectively). The findings support the importance of finger strength and upper-body power; changes in female anthropometric data over the last decade provide insight into the changing nature of the sport.

摘要

尽管攀岩运动越来越受欢迎,参与人数也在不断增加,但针对该人群的人体测量学和表现数据却有限。本研究比较了 55 名经验丰富的女性攀岩者的特征,这些女性攀岩者根据自我报告的能力分为三个类别(低级别 [ADV-L]、高级别 [ADV-H] 和精英级别 [ELT])。评估了攀岩经验、身体尺寸、身体成分、柔韧性、上下肢力量和手指力量的数据。ELT 攀岩者在年龄(平均差异 [MD] = 8.8-9.8 岁;尽管攀爬年限的差异较小,MD = 1.6-2.4 年)、每周攀爬和训练时间(MD = 3.0-3.7 小时和 MD = 0.9-1.6 小时)以及上半身力量(MD = 12.9-16.6 厘米)和手指力量(MD = 51.6-65.4 N)方面与 ADV 组有显著差异。线性回归分析表明,手指力量和上半身力量与能力相关,尤其是在调整描述性和人体测量学变量后(指力与抱石和运动相关度分别为 53%和 45%;上半身力量与抱石和运动相关度分别为 60%和 39%)。研究结果支持手指力量和上半身力量的重要性;过去十年女性人体测量数据的变化为该运动的变化性质提供了深入了解。
